Gibb's history with RBs is to "acquire" the veteran, featured big or rugged back with a 3rd down scat back as the secondary RB.

Riggins- Joe Washington

Riggins - Keith Griffin

Rogers, Riggins - Griffin

Rogers - Kelvin Bryant

T. Smith - K. Bryant

Riggs - Byner

Byner - Ricky Ervins

I don't see him changing what has worked for him in the past. Gibbs did not want his featured back to be a rookie who is still learning to play in the NFL.
